blockly > icone > MutatorIcon

lezione icon.MutatorIcon

Un'icona che consente all'utente di modificare la forma del blocco.

Ad esempio, può essere utilizzato per aggiungere ulteriori campi o input al blocco.

Firma:

export declare class MutatorIcon extends Icon implements IHasBubble 

Estensioni:icona

Implementazioni: IHasBubble

Costruttori

Costruttore Modificatori Descrizione
(constructor)(flyoutBlockTypes, sourceBlock) Crea una nuova istanza della classe MutatorIcon

Proprietà

Proprietà Modificatori Tipo Descrizione
sourceBlock

protected

readonly

BlockSvg
TIPO

static

readonly

IconType<MutatorIcon> La stringa del tipo utilizzata per identificare l'icona.
PESO

static

readonly

(non dichiarato) Il peso di questa icona rispetto alle altre icone. Le icone con valori di ponderazione più positivi vengono visualizzate più in là verso la fine del blocco.

Metodi

Metodo Modificatori Descrizione
applyColour()
bubbleIsVisible()
Disposizione (())
getSize()
getType()
getWeight()
getWorkspace()
initView(pointerdownListener)
isClickableInFlyout()
onClick()
onLocationChange(blockOrigin)
setBubbleVisible(visible)
updateCollapsed()